
Governor Babagana Umara Zulum of Borno State has called on the North East Development Commission (NEDC) on Wednesday to focus on tangible projects with lasting benefits for the north east region.
FCNN gathered that he listed security, Dry Inland Ports, African Intercontinental Free Trade Zone, independent electricity supply, and road networks as key priorities for the region.
Zulum emphasized the need for the NEDC to prioritize projects that can provide maximum benefits, given that it has gone beyond 50% of its lifespan.

The Governor expects NEDC to have a yardstick to measure its performance and achieve tangible results. He also warned that the governors of the northeast region will hold the NEDC management and board accountable for their performance.
He assured the NEDC management of the governors’ commitment to support the commission in achieving its mandate.
The State Minister of Regional Development, Uba Maigari Ahmodu, emphasized the need for close collaboration with the North East Governors Forum to achieve the North East Stabilisation and Development Plan (NESDP).
He assured that the Ministry of Regional Development will supervise NEDC to ensure it achieves its goals.
The delegation that met with Governor Zulum included the chairman of the House of Representatives Committee on NEDC, Hon. Usman Zannah, and other committee members.
The Chairman of the NEDC board, Major General Paul C. Tarfa (Rtd), and the MD/CEO of the commission, Mohammed Goni Alkali, were also present.
